This television show first aired on September 22, 2003. The show stared Jon Cryer, Charlie Sheen and Angus T. Jones. This comedy show is about a jingle writer, Charlie and his brother Alan, and the son of Alan, Jake, Charlie's brother, moves in after a divorce, along with the brother's son and begins to complicate Charlie's life, creating a fun and laughable show that entertained the television audience. Charlie lives in a beach front house in Malibu and is living a free wheeling lifestyle, which one day comes to an end when his brother moves in with his son after becoming divorced. Charlie's life then begins to become less free wheeling and more complicated than ever before. The New York Times considered this show to be the biggest hit comedy in 2011. The show did go on to become ranked among the top 20 television shows that aired each season since it first began to be broadcast on television.
Much like many other shows, this one had plenty of quest stars appearing on this sitcom. Some of the quest stars were people like John Amos, who played Ed, the boy friend of Chelsea's Father, Susan Blakely, who played Angie, who was an author whom Charlie met inside of a book store.
Others who made an appearance on the show were Elvis Costello, who played himself, playing a poker buddy, Emilio Estevez as Andy, who was a long time friend of Charlie's, Morgan Fairchild s Donna, who was the ego of Charlie.
